Wasp
Wasps are a unique creature they are in the order of Hymenoptera and suborder of Apocrita that is neither a bee nor ant. Now I know that we humans think as bees as all flying stinging things. but that is not true. Wasps are in a order and family of their own. A quick fact to know is there are over 4,000 kinds of wasps in the United States.
These type of wasps include Hornets, Yellow Jackets, Paper Wasps and Potter Wasps just to name a few. All a very aggressive and will sting if felt threatened. The most aggressive type of wasp in this group is the Hornet (usually a bald face hornet) These wasps will attack in large numbers if their hive(nest) is threatened. The average Hornet nest contains aprox. 5000 wasps. there have been other that have had over 250000 wasps in it. When a nest is disturbed the wasp that is Guarding the nest(which is known as a Sentinel) sends out a alarm pheromone which signals the other wasp in the nest to defend the nest at all costs. African Honey Bees
Africanized hybrid bees have become the preferred types of bee for beekeeping in Central America and in other tropical areas of South America because of improved productivity. However, in most areas the productivity is not important as these bees are very aggressicve!! It get these atributes from it African relatives that make it less desirable for domestic beekeeping. Specifically the Africanized bee:
- Tends to swarm more frequently and go farther than other types of honey bees.
- Will migrate as part of a seasonal response to lowered food supply.
- Is more likely to “abandon”—the entire colony leaves the hive and relocates—in response to stress.
- Has greater defensiveness when in a resting swarm,
- Lives more often in ground cavities than the European types.
- Guards the hive aggressively, with a larger alarm zone around the hive.
